Images

  • Western blot - Anti-PCSK9 antibody [mAbcam84041] (ab84041)
    Western blot - Anti-PCSK9 antibody [mAbcam84041] (ab84041)
    All lanes : Anti-PCSK9 antibody [mAbcam84041] (ab84041) at 1/500 dilution

    Lane 1 : Human heart tissue lysate - total protein (ab29431)
    Lane 2 : Human kidney tissue lysate - total protein (ab30203)

    Lysates/proteins at 20 µg per lane.

    Secondary
    All lanes : Goat polyclonal Secondary Antibody to Mouse IgM (HRP) at 1/3000 dilution

    Developed using the ECL technique.

    Performed under reducing conditions.

    Predicted band size: 74 kDa
    Observed band size: 74 kDa
    Additional bands at: 30 kDa, 40 kDa. We are unsure as to the identity of these extra bands.


    Exposure time: 1 minute
  •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-PCSK9 antibody [mAbcam84041] (ab84041)
    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-PCSK9 antibody [mAbcam84041] (ab84041)
    ICC/IF image of ab84041 stained Hek293 cells. The cells were 4% PFA fixed (10 min) and then incubated in 1%BSA / 10% normal goat serum / 0.3M glycine in 0.1% PBS-Tween for 1h to permeabilise the cells and block non-specific protein-protein interactions. The cells were then incubated with the antibody (ab84041, 5µg/ml) overnight at +4°C. The secondary antibody (green) was ab96879, DyLight® 488 goat anti-mouse IgG (H+L) used at a 1/250 dilution for 1h. Alexa Fluor® 594 WGA was used to label plasma membranes (red) at a 1/200 dilution for 1h. DAPI was used to stain the cell nuclei (blue) at a concentration of 1.43µM. This antibody also gave a positive result in 4% PFA fixed (10 min) HepG2 and MCF7 cells at 5µg/ml.
